About the Brewery
Hubbard's Cave
Niles, IL
From their beloved Fresh Series IIPAs to their decadent Pot De Creme Stouts, Hubbard’s Cave keeps Chicago-land craft fiends thirsting for more.
And that should come as no surprise: Hubbard’s is the American-style arm of the famed Une Annee Sour and Wild brewery! And while the Windy City certainly embraces the tart-side, Hubbard’s clean, innovative, and unusual takes on classic styles — like their Mexican chocolate-inspired El Zacatón Imperial Stout — have taken the city by storm.
